Ranchers' Friend and Farmers' Foe: Reshaping Nature with Beaver Reintroduction in California (2014)

unapi

The twentieth-century project to restore animals to their former ranges often relied on the common support of sportsmen's groups, wildlife managers, and biologists. Beavers were common but controversial subjects of early reintroduction programs throughout the North American West. In California, rapidly expanding industrial agriculture created a particularly intense conflict over the fate of remaining beaver habitat. Advocates turned to higher elevation ranch lands to relocate problem beavers, emphasizing the economic benefits of raising water tables and reclaiming the potential resource repositories of the foothills and mountains. These habitat extensions were a novel means of commoditizing an animal whose status shifted from harmful to beneficial depending on location and situation.
